In 2020-2021, 66,787 communication and media studies students received their degree, making the major the 10th most popular in the country. In 2019-2020, communication and media studies gra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$34,115 and had an average of $25,414 in loans still to pay off.

Across Nebraska, there were 156 communication and media studies graduates with average earnings and debt of $34,716 and $33,175 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 11 communication and media studies graduates with average earnings and debt of $54,838 and $0 respectively.

For this year’s “Most Well Attended Communications Major in Nebraska for a Master’s” ranking, we looked at 2 colleges that offer a degree in communication and media studies. This ranking identifies schools that graduate the most students in communication and media studies.

Most Well Attended Communications Major in Nebraska for a Master’s

The colleges and universities below are the best for nebraska master’s degree communications students.

1

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end University of Nebraska at Omaha. The school came in at #1 for the Most Well Attended Communications Major in Nebraska for a Master’s. University of Nebraska at Omaha is a fairly large public school situated in Omaha, Nebraska. It awarded 8 masters’s communications degrees in 2020-2021.

The undergrad student loan default rate at the school is 2.0%, which is quite low when compared to the national default rate of 10.1%.

2

Out of the 2 schools in the Most Well Attended Communications Major in Nebraska for a Master’s that were part of this year’s ranking, University of Nebraska - Lincoln landed the #2 spot on the list. This large school is located in Lincoln, Nebraska, and it awarded 3 masters’s communications degrees in 2020-2021.

The undergrad student loan default rate at the school is 2.2%, which is quite low when compared to the national default rate of 10.1%. Students who start out at the school are likely to stick around. The freshman retention rate is 85%.
